Man Utd 6 -0 Newcastle

Saturday, January 12th, 2008

RonaldoUnited played Newcastle today. It was an evening kick-off and with Arsenal only drawing with Birmingham if we won we would go top.

It was a frustrating first half ending 0-0. I thought it was going to be one of those games!! We had several chances but finishing was abit poor. We had the majority of the possession. Newcastle had some chances and a goal by Owen was dis-allowed for offside (replays show it was fine).

Second half was much better and the game finished 6-0. Ronaldo scored a hat-trick (finally!! he has scored 2 goals loads of times for us). Thats now 22 goals this season – only 1 less than the whole of last season!! AMAZING!!!

Tevez got a couple – although his 2nd was arguably not quite over the line. Rio also got one – a strikers finish!

The only negative was Rooney not scoring – he had his chances and was denied by great saves by Given.

Its just wrong!!

Monday, January 7th, 2008

Beckham has been training with the Arsenal football team to keep himself fit while his team LA Galaxy are not playing (they missed out on the play-offs).

Apparently he will be training with the reserve team and occassionally the first team. I reckon Arsene Wenger will be getting Becks to take freekicks against Almunia!!
